The algorithm of image fusion based on multiscale geometric analysis and particle swarm optimization(PSO) is mainly discussed in the paper.Firstly, the concept of multiscale geometric analysis is analyzed in theory and wavelet transform, curvelet transform, contourlet transform and NSCT are analyzed in detail. Then the theoretical basis of PSO algorithm is introduced, and the formulas of the standard PSO are given. Secondly, the basic levels of image fusion and evaluating methods for quality of fused images are introduced. Finally, the algorithm of fusion of multi-focus images, medical images and remote sensing image based on multiscale geometric analysis and particle swarm optimization is proposed. This method takes multiple fused images received from fusion algorithm based on multiscale transform as initial particle swarm and takes two evaluation indicators as objectives for optimization.When different types of source images are processed for optimization with the fusion method the paper proposes, according to different imaging mechanism and fusion purposes, different evaluation indicators are selected as the objective functions of the multi-objective optimization. In the case of multi-focus image, average gradient and information entropy are selected as the objective; in the case of medicine image, average gradient and root mean square error are selected as the objective; in the case of remote sensing image, spectral correlation coefficient and average gradient are selected as the objective. Considering the practical application of PSO in image fusion, a new formula of inertia weight and the reasonable selection of optimal solution are designed. Results of different input are studied in image fusion of multi-focus images.Finally, based on the fusion method the paper proposed, experiments of three types of images are done; Simulation results and quantitative evaluating parameters consistently show the algorithm has better fusion performance.
